Recommendation Tracking - Future of Kirkgate Market

To consider a report of the Head of Scrutiny and Member Development on progress made in responding to the recommendations arising from the previous Scrutiny Inquiry into the future of Kirkgate Market.

At the request of the Chair, the Chief Economic Development Officer and the Head of City Centre and Markets outlined the key issues within the report highlighting the progress made towards the twelve recommendations.

 

Councillor G Harper and Liz Laughton were also invited to comment on the recommendations.

 

Detailed discussion ensued on the contents of the report and appendices and Board Members raised their concerns on the apparent lack of progress made against the majority of the recommendations since July 2011.

 

Following discussions, the Board made a number of changes to the proposed category status recommendations identified in Appendix 2 of the report which were duly noted by the Board’s Principal Scrutiny Adviser.

 

In concluding, the Chair agreed to raise the above concerns with the Executive Member, Development and the Economy.

d)  That a report of the Director of City Development be presented to the next Board meeting providing the following information on the:

 

·  Relevant Executive Board minute of 27th July 2011

·  Steps taken to comply with the Executive Board’s decision of 27th July 2011 to transfer Kirkgate Market to an arms length company and the instruction given to officers to further investigate what form this should taken in response to the Scrutiny Inquiry Report on the Future of Kirkgate Market

·  Details of the work that has been commissioned to establish the optimum size of the future market, together with consultant costs

·  Details of the lettings policy for the indoor market, together with exempt information showing the amount each trader pays.

·  Market traders signage and the payment of a bond

·  Action taken to facilitate meetings between the market traders and Hammersons

·  Works that are to be carried out by the Council in the indoor market at a cost of £200,000 and whether market traders have now been notified of this fact
